Perrysville Saloons Vote Fails. Council to Decide
A special election results 76 against and 40 for saloons in Perrysville. the issue now rests with the City Council. Teachers' Certificates Granted at Wooster Exam
Thirty two applicants sought teachers' certificates in Wooster on Saturday Oct 6. Twenty earned certificates across durations eight, twelve, and six months. Recipients include W Paul Springville Reason Snyder Wooster Ezra Dunham Wooster D W McGuire Wooster P B Blosser Maysville Hoover Orrville Cushman Shreve Tawney Reedsburg Parrot Fredericksburg Rebecca Yost Clinton Summit Co Gertrude Reese Mt Eaton Ella Reese Mt Eaton Suttle Burton City McCullough Orrville Bartleby Orrville Billman Smithville Jameson Applecreek Orr Fredericksburg Orr Reedsburg. Next exam at Smithville Oct 20 at 9 a m.

Probate Court Proceedings and Estate Transfers Summary
Probate actions include Will of David Houmand and Will of Frederick Flory probated with widows accepting under wills. Will of Lydia Shisler filed for probate. various guardianship accounts due hearings December 5 and November 12. Administrators Josiah Clinker and Levi Firestone seek disposal of claims and land sales. distributions and inventories ordered. Transfers list numerous real estate deeds in West Salem, Orrville, and Franklin township totaling thousands of dollars.
